Birnam Wood III Committees - 2011
1. Volunteer/Action/Communications/Think/Tank [VACTT] - This is the initial think tank which serves as an umbrella to all committees now and in the future. All ideas, suggestions, goals, recommendations, concerns and comments are encouraged. All homeowners may participate in this communications committee just by attending the meeting. The meetings of this committee are anticipated to take place at the end of every scheduled HOA quarterly meeting (1/4/11, 4/5/11, 7/5/11 and 10/4/11).
